The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ress, July 2, 1926, takes pleasure in presenting the Soldier’s Medal to Private First Class Albert E. Herron, United States Army, for heroism at the risk of life not involving conflict with an armed enemy as a member of Headquarters and Service Company, 24th Armored Engineer Battalion, 4th Armored Division, Fort Hood, Texas, at Belton, Texas on 10 January 1957. Upon learning that two elderly people were trapped in a burning house, Private First Class Herron unhesitatingly went to their aid. Entry through the front door was found to be impossible due to flame and smoke. Private First Class Herron wrapped a wet cloth around his face and entered through the back door. He discovered an invalid lady lying on a burning bed. Private First Class Herron carried her from the house and at the same time led her partially blind husband to safety. Minutes after the rescue was accomplished, the house collapsed. Private First Class Herron’s courageous action in face of immediate danger reflects great credit on himself in the military service.
